Why Road Design Matters in Auto Accident CasesRoad design plays a critical role in auto accident cases, especially in Alabama, where over 134,000 crashes were reported in a recent year, many linked to hazardous road conditions. Poor lighting, inadequate signage, sharp curves, and missing guardrails can contribute to serious accidents. In legal cases, flawed road design may shift liability toward government agencies or contractors. The Influence of Road Layout

The design of a roadway can make or break driving conditions. How drivers handle the area depends on intersections, curves, and lanes. Complex junctions can create confusion, which in turn leads to crashes. Drivers may not receive an adequate early warning of a sharp curve, and the accident ensues. Roadways will be less risky when they are organized, as they can guide vehicle users about the right way.

Signage and Markings

Highly visible road signs and markings are critical for safe driving. Speed limits, lane changes, and pedestrian crossings can all be tracked as well. Drivers also make judgment errors when signs are absent or ambiguous. This ambiguity can cause accidents. Properly placed and maintained signage allows drivers to make better decisions out on the road.

The Importance of Lighting

When coming on poorly lit roads, opposing shadows can mask the obstructions and restrict visibility from oncoming automobiles, the specialists stated. Good illumination helps a driver to see everything in front of their vehicle so they can react to potential danger. Proper streetlight installations and maintenance can reduce nighttime accidents massively.

Pedestrian and Cyclist Considerations

It is also important to design roads with the safety of pedestrians and cyclists in mind. These vulnerable road users can be protected through dedicated lanes and crossings. Lack of infrastructure means higher risks for pedestrians and cyclists. By designing roads with these users in mind, we can help avoid accidents and create a safer space for all road users.

Traffic Flow Management and Its Implications

Smooth and efficient traffic flow is, therefore, necessary in minimizing vehicular congestion and avoiding high-risk collisions. Traffic signals, roundabouts, and other devices regulate vehicle movement. In the absence of these controls, however, intersections can become congested and chaotic, resulting in accidents. Traffic management strategies can help reduce the risk of collisions and improve safety.

Influence on Legal Cases

The way a road is designed can also affect the outcome of the accident in court. Liability may change when road conditions are part of the cause of the accident. At times, attorneys look at road design to establish whether it contributed. The impact of road structures can be crucial in criminal and civil proceedings, also affecting the associated compensation and accountability.
